Abstract

A method for digital archiving of art objects using a multispectral reflection model is proposed. The device consists of a lighting system, goniometric rotating arms, and a vision system with a two-shot six-band camera. Parameters are derived from the multiband camera with an optical filter and a device that measures the distribution of light reflection intensity on an object’s surface. For digital archiving and computer graphics rendering, multispectral reflection properties of the object are estimated from goniospectral measurements. Multiple images of the object’s surface are acquired at different illumination and viewing directions. Under the same conditions, reflection model parameters are estimated from sensor measurements of the reflection intensity of the object’s surface. Finally, we rendered a realistic image of the object and visually confirmed the validity of the proposed method.
